PRESS RELEASE:
Millions of
Dollars Redirected HepCop
has publicly denounced the National Institutes of Health (NIH) for
spending millions of dollars budgeted for Hepatitis C
(HCV) on other research agendas. |
HCV Grants Allocated for HIV & HIV/HCV Research Projects
The NIH tells congress it's spending money on HCV research. NIH
tells advocates it should be grateful HIV is funding HCV. Millions
of dollars budgeted under the title of HCV research are
awarded to determine such outcomes as, Couples-Based HIV/STI
Prevention for Injecting Drug Users in Kazakhstan ($676,058),
Effects of HIV & Host Genetics in China ($645,840), and Nutritional
Status In HIV Hispanic Drug Abusers ($660,216).
Many of these studies may or may not mention HCV outcomes. But... be
grateful...
